GA Kiteboarding Spark 2026
The Spark 2026 elevates all-round performance with a smooth, balanced flight character, improved depower, and enhanced upwind efficiency — making it the most intuitive and versatile Spark to date. Built for riders of all levels who want easy handling, excellent stability, and a wide performance range, the Spark continues to deliver the perfect blend of freeride comfort, control, and progression-ready power.
For 2026, the Spark features the brand-new ForceTec Dacron supplied by Challenge across the leading edge and struts. Reinforced with ripstop-style yarns, this upgraded material significantly reduces deformation under load, resulting in a cleaner, more stable canopy. The improved structural response translates directly into better control, a smoother ride, and more efficient overall performance.
Small but impactful refinements to the profile were introduced with one clear goal: improving upwind performance. The result is a faster, more efficient Spark that climbs upwind noticeably better while remaining extremely stable, especially when depowered. Riders will immediately feel the calmer canopy behavior — less movement, more control, and better handling in gusty or overpowered situations.
The leading-edge diameters were recalculated to achieve a thinner center section and a slightly increased diameter in the tips. This adjustment enhances overall balance and makes the Spark feel crisper and more precise in its turning response, while maintaining the smooth and predictable character the Spark series is known for.
A newly optimized bridle setup further improves load distribution across all bridle lines, enhancing depower efficiency and responsiveness. The Spark 2026 offers a noticeably wider wind range, cleaner power management, and better control when fully sheeted out.

GA KITES 2026 SPARK
| SIZE | STRUTS | BAR WIDTH (CM) | WINDRANGE | FLAT AREA (sqm) | PROJ. AREA (SQM) | FLAT AR |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 5.0 | 3 | 46 | 23 – 45+ | 5 | 3.34 | 4,6 |
| 6.0 | 3 | 46 | 20 – 38 | 6 | 4 | 4,6 |
| 7.0 | 3 | 46 | 17 – 33 | 7 | 4.67 | 4,6 |
| 8.0 | 3 | 46 | 16 – 32 | 8 | 5.34 | 4,6 |
| 9.0 | 3 | 52 | 14 – 30 | 9 | 6.01 | 4,6 |
| 10.0 | 3 | 52 | 13 – 29 | 10 | 6.67 | 4,6 |
| 11.0 | 3 | 52 | 12 – 28 | 11 | 7.34 | 4,6 |
| 12.0 | 3 | 52 | 10 – 25 | 12 | 8 | 4,6 |
| 15.0 | 3 | 52 | 8 – 22 | 15 | 10 | 4,6 |
| 17.0 | 3 | 52 | 6 – 19 | 17 | 11.34 | 4,6 |
